[RETAIL CRIME & THEFT] Last week, Congress advanced the NSBA-endorsed Combating Organized Retail Crime Act (CORCA), to expand federal enforcement tools targeting organized theft rings, cargo theft, and interstate criminal networks that drive up costs and disrupt operations for small businesses and small firms nationwide.

THIS WEEK, Congress is considering making the “Rule of Two” a permanent protection for Small-Business contractors, helping ensure federal agencies prioritize Small Businesses when at least two qualified firms can compete for the work. cc/ House Committee on Small Business
The move would strengthen opportunities for Small Businesses, improve fairness in federal contracting, and provide greater long-term certainty for the nation's most important economic community competing in the government marketplace.
